START CAST BREAKOUTS PREVENTATIVE PREDICTION USING MULTI-WAY PCA TECHNOLOGY

摘要

Breakouts during continuous caster start-up operations are of major concern in the steel-making industry, because they can lead to severe damage to equipment, significant process downtime, and potential safety consequences. As a multivariate statistical (MVS) analysis tool, Multi-way PCA (MPCA) is applied for monitoring the start-up operation of a continuous caster in order to predict potential start cast breakouts so the caster can be automatically stopped to avoid the catastrophic event. It is shown to provide good prediction of start cast breakouts resulting in significant savings in operating and maintenance costs. An on-line start cast monitoring system has been successfully implemented at Dofasco's # 2 continuous caster.
